The censure motion presented by the Chega party is being discussed in Parliament during the afternoon. This motion was presented by the leader of Chega, André Ventura.
During the discussion, André Ventura directed his criticism at Luís Neves, a government member or political figure targeted by the party.
The remaining parties represented in Parliament have already announced they will not approve the censure motion, which makes its viability unlikely.
The censure motion is a parliamentary instrument that allows the opposition to question the government's actions, although, without majority support in the assembly, it is destined to be rejected.
